Overview
Quip
Quip transforms how your team works by consolidating documents, spreadsheets, and real-time chat into a single, living workspace. Instead of toggling between disconnected apps and endless email chains, you can build project plans, analyze data, and make decisions in one place. Because it is a Salesforce company, it allows you to embed live Salesforce data directly into your documents, ensuring your team always works with the most current customer information.
You can use it to streamline everything from account planning to product launches across any device. The platform eliminates version control issues by allowing multiple people to edit the same document simultaneously while discussing changes in an integrated sidebar. It is particularly effective for sales and service teams who need to bridge the gap between their CRM data and their daily collaborative workflows.
TeamSnap
TeamSnap simplifies the chaos of organizing youth, recreational, and competitive sports. You can manage every aspect of your season from a single dashboard, whether you are a coach coordinating a local team or an administrator overseeing an entire league. The platform eliminates the need for messy email chains and paper forms by centralizing your roster, schedule, and payment collection in one accessible location.
You can track player availability for upcoming games, send instant alerts for field changes, and collect registration fees directly through the app. It solves the headache of last-minute coordination and financial tracking, allowing you to spend less time on paperwork and more time on the field. The software scales from individual teams to massive multi-sport organizations with dedicated tools for every stakeholder.

Quip Features
- Living Documents Create and edit documents with your team in real-time, combining text, images, and task lists in one shared space.
- Collaborative Spreadsheets Build powerful spreadsheets that support over 400 functions and allow you to discuss specific cells with your teammates.
- Salesforce Integration View and update live Salesforce records directly within your documents to keep your CRM data accurate and actionable.
- Integrated Team Chat Discuss projects instantly with built-in chat rooms and 1:1 messaging attached to every document and spreadsheet.
- Mobile Optimization Access, edit, and comment on all your work from any device with a native mobile experience that works offline.
- Process Templates Standardize your team's success by using pre-built templates for account plans, creative briefs, and project trackers.
TeamSnap Features
- Availability Tracking. See exactly who is coming to every game or practice in real-time so you can plan your lineup accordingly.
- Real-Time Messaging. Send instant alerts to the entire team or specific groups to communicate last-minute schedule changes or rainouts.
- Schedule Syncing. Sync your team calendar with Apple, Google, or Outlook so you never miss a game or team event.
- Online Registration. Create custom forms to collect player data and documents electronically without the need for physical paperwork.
- Payment Collection. Invoiced players and collect registration fees or team dues securely via credit card or ACH transfers.
- Health Check. Screen participants with digital health surveys before events to ensure a safe environment for all players.
